Cleaning the Interior
If defects such as white stripes, fading, or scratches begin
to appear in printouts, you may need to clean the thermal
head and rollers. In particular, white stripes and lines tend
to appear when using the 2UPC-C14 series or 2UPC-C48
series printing pack after printing a large quantity of prints
with the 2UPC-C13 series or 2UPC-C15 series printing
pack.
You can check whether cleaning is necessary in the
confirmation screen for the remaining ink ribbon. To
display the confirmation screen for the remaining ink
ribbon, touch the top right corner of the Start Guide screen
twice in succession.
When the total number of prints exceeds a fixed value, a
message indicating that cleaning is necessary appears. If
this occurs, touch the button to begin cleaning.
The following items are necessary to perform interior
cleaning.
The cleaning cartridge supplied with the printer
The cleaning sheet (Cleaning Sheet) supplied with the
printing pack
Print paper
The cleaning cartridge is reusable. Do not throw it away.
As the cleaning sheet in not reusable, discard it after the
first use.
If there is insufficient print paper remaining, an error
may occur. If this occurs, replace the print paper and
begin the cleaning process again.
1
Touch the button.
2
Enter the administrator password.
3
Remove the paper tray.
4
Check the remaining amount of print paper.
